    We present the NLO corrections for the quark induced forward production of a jet with an associated rapidity gap. We make use of Lipatov's QCD high energy effective action to calculate the real emission contributions to the so-called Mueller-Tang impact factor. We combine them with the previously calculated virtual corrections and verify ultraviolet and collinear finiteness of the final result.Comment: 29 pages, many figure

    This study determines the accessibility level and benefits of Social Media Platforms (SMPs) as supplements for students’ learning opportunities in the new normal.  A Mixed method was utilized. The participants of the study were the randomly selected fifty (50) Grade 10 students. Data were gathered using a survey questionnaire. Results revealed that SMPs are accessible in terms of the availability of gadgets, internet connectivity, and time. Respondents accessed SMPs using their mobile phones and laptops and spent more than 8 hours accessing SMPs using mobile data connections. Respondents always use Facebook and Messenger, often use YouTube, TikTok, and Instagram, and sometimes use other SMPs. They considered SMPs significant, effective, and beneficial in accessing learning opportunities such as updated with their assignments, learning tasks, announcements, and supplementary materials.  The accessibility level implies that students are digitally equipped with knowledge in using the platforms and this shows possibilities of using SMPs in the new normal. It is recommended that SMPs be utilized in crafting activities in New Normal English Program to supplement learning opportunities among students while properly monitored and regulated by parents and teachers. Future studies may look into the use of SMPs in various levels of literacy and educational contexts

    We present the results for the calculation of the forward jet vertex associated to a rapidity gap (coupling of a hard pomeron to the jet) in the Balitsky-Fadin-Kuraev-Lipatov (BFKL) formalism at next-to-leading order (NLO). We handle the real emission contributions making use of the high energy effective action proposed by Lipatov, valid for multi-Regge and quasi-multi-Regge kinematics. This result is important since it allows, together with the NLO non-forward gluon Green function, to perform NLO studies of jet production in diffractive events (Mueller-Tang dijets, as a well-known example).Comment: 12 pages, some figure

    BackgroundThe PhotoVoice method has shown substantial promise for work with youth in metropolitan areas, yet its potential for use with Latino youth from agricultural areas has not been well documented.ObjectivesThis project was designed to teach environmental health to 15 high school youth while building their individual and community capacity for studying and addressing shared environmental concerns. The project also aimed to test the utility of PhotoVoice with Latino agricultural youth.MethodsFifteen members of the Youth Community Council (YCC), part of a 15-year project with farmworker families in Salinas, CA, took part in a 12-week PhotoVoice project. Their pictures captured the assets and strengths of their community related to environmental health, and were then analyzed by participants. A multi-pronged evaluation was conducted.ResultsYCC members identified concerns such as poor access to affordable, healthy foods and lack of safe physical spaces in which to play, as well as assets, including caring adults and organizations, and open spaces in surrounding areas. Participants presented their findings on radio, television, at local community events, and to key policy makers. The youth also developed two action plans, a successful 5K run/walk and a school recycling project, still in progress. Evaluation results included significant changes in such areas as perceived ability to make presentations, leadership, and self-confidence, as well as challenges including transportation, group dynamics, and gaining access to people in power.ConclusionThe PhotoVoice method shows promise for environmental health education and youth development in farmworker communities

    Transforming growth factor β-1, encoded by the TGFB1 gene, is a cytokine that plays a central role in many physiologic and pathogenic processes, having pleiotropic effects on cell proliferation, differentiation, migration and survival. Regulatory activity for this gene has been demonstrated for approximately 3.0 kb between positions -2,665 and +423 from its translational start site. This region includes two promoter sites, two negative regulatory elements and two enhancers, in addition to part of the protein’s signal peptide. An important amount of polymorphism has been reported for this gene, including 17 promoter and exon 1 alleles defined on the basis or 18 polymorphisms . Polymorphism in TGFB1 has been associated to differential levels of expression of this cytokine and to genetic risk in cancer and hematopoietic stem cell (HSCT) and organ transplantation. In this report, we extend this list by presenting novel alleles formed by new polymorphic positions and a new combination of the previously described polymorphisms. These novel alleles have been found during the typing of a cohort of unrelated haematopoietic stem cell transplantation patient-donor pairs, and of healthy volunteer donors

    El presente trabajo consiste en un estudio de caso desarrollado en la empresa SBC, Lda. El objetivo principal de este trabajo fue analizar los factores financieros y no financieros, que influencian el desempeño financiero de la empresa medido por la rentabilidad del capital propio. Utilizando la regresión robusta recurriendo al software R se constato que la variación de los indicadores financieros y no financieros parecen influenciar el desempeño financiero de la empresa.This work consists in a case study developed in the SBC, Lda. The main objective of this study was to analyse the financial and non-financial factors that influence the company's financial performance as measured by return on equity. Using robust regression with the software R it was verified that the change in turnover, customer satisfaction and financial autonomy are positively correlated and statistically significant for a 10% significance level, so it follows that the non financial indicators also may contribute to financial performance

    In this paper a methodology that extends the dynamic harmonic domain (DHD) analysis of large networks is presented. The method combines DHD analysis and discrete companion circuit modeling resulting in a powerful analytic technique called dynamic companion harmonic circuit modeling. It provides for a complete dynamic harmonic analysis of the system while preserving the advantages of discrete companion circuit models. The methodology is illustrated by its application to a three-node power system, where reactive power compensation is achieved using a fixed-capacitor, thyristor-controlled reactor (FC-TCR) and its control system

    Hemangiomas account for 0.4-0.6% of all tumors of the parotid gland and most of them occur in children, never - theless in adults hemangiomas are very rare. We report the case of a 62 year old woman with a mass in the parotid right tail associated with fluctuating swelling episodes unrelated to meals and with a slowly progressive growth. The provisional diagnosis was a pleomorphic adenoma, so a right superficial parotidectomy was performed. During surgery, the macroscopic appearance makes suspect a vascular lesion. The histopathological result was a cavernous hemangioma. The classic clinical presentation of a parotid hemangioma is an intraglandular mass associated or not with skin lesions characterized by reddish macules and/or papules, and a vibration or pulsation when palpating the parotid region. In imaging tests, phleboliths could be observed which are very suggestive of a hemangioma or a vascular malformation. In the absence of these signs, the diagnosis could be difficult, particularly in an adult due to its low prevalence, with about 50 cases reported worldwide. However a hemangioma should be considered in the differential diagnosis of parotid tumors in adults
